Lending Practices, Strategies for Current Economy Addressed in Nov. 1-4 Lending Council Conference
Discover innovative lending practices and strategies to deal with the challenges created during the current economic crisis at the 15th annual CUNA Lending Council Conference, taking place Nov. 1-4 in San Diego. Learn how to turn today's challenges into tomorrow's successes during "Earning Your Way Out." This Monday morning breakout session will reveal the strategic and financial opportunities available to credit unions in mortgage lending and housing finance, among others. Speaker Joe Brancucci, CEO and chair of Prime Alliance Solutions, will disclose six lending strategies and one super strategy with the potential to reshape credit unions. On Tuesday, the "Lending to the Newly Credit Impaired" panel will explore the challenges and potential opportunities of lending to this growing category of Americans. The panel will offer best practices for combining evaluation of members' character and historical experience with their current credit situation. It will also address needed risk assessment measures for lending to these borrowers and reveal some of the most current tools for assessing credit history and credit trends. The roller coaster ride of the past year has been enough to turn anyone's stomach, so we're focusing this conference on smart lending practices to help credit union professionals turn the corner and stress less," said Bill Vogeney, co-chair of the council's conference committee and senior vice president and chief lending officer for Ent FCU in Colorado Springs, Colo.
